- MVC(ModelViewController)是一個設計模式,使用MVC應用程式被分成三個核心部件:模型、檢視、控制器。它們各自處理自己的任務。M是指資料模型,V是指使用者介面,C則是控制器。使用MVC的目的是將M和V的實現程式碼分離,從而使同一個程式可以應用於不同的表現形式。MODEL:封裝了所有的...
- 23040
- MVC是當前最為流行的開發模式,新手一定不要把MVC理解為三層架構,在MVC中有一個核心的東西,那就是路由。路由就相當於家裡要使用很多電器,電器肯定要使用電的,需要有一個有很多插孔的電排插,每個電器通過連線電排插的插座,電器都可以使用了,那麼這裡的電排插就相當於路由,由路由,電...
- 10524
- SpringMVC工作流程描述:1、使用者向伺服器傳送請求,請求被Spring前端控制ServeltDispatcherServlet捕獲2、DispatcherServlet對請求URL進行解析,得到請求資源識別符號(URI)。然後根據該URI,呼叫HandlerMapping獲得該Handler配置的所有相關的物件(包括Handler物件以及Handler物件對應...
- 17265
- 介面是一種功能強大的程式設計工具,因為它們使您可以將物件的定義與其實現分開.以下是msdn的一些觀點:1)介面更適合於您的應用程式需要許多可能不相關的物件型別以提供某些功能的情況.2)介面比基類更靈活,因為您可以定義一個可以實現多個介面的實現.3)在不必從基類繼承實現的情...
- 32522
- MVC是Java中的一種設計模式,在你寫程式的時候一定得按照這樣的模式寫程式碼,他的目的是為了減少層與層之間的耦合,方便後續的維護M——指的是Model,即模型,在實際的開發中我們的實體類就是我們的模型,再通俗一點就是你寫了很多private修飾的變數,然後寫了很多get、set方法的類就叫...
- 26082
- MVC(ModelViewController)是一個設計模式,使用MVC應用程式被分成三個核心部件:模型、檢視、控制器。它們各自處理自己的任務。M是指資料模型,V是指使用者介面,C則是控制器。使用MVC的目的是將M和V的實現程式碼分離,從而使同一個程式可以應用於不同的表現形式。...
- 10287
- MVC模式就是架構模式的一種,它對我的啟發特別大。我覺得它不僅適用於開發軟體,也適用於其他廣泛的設計和組織工作。下面是我對MVC模式的一些個人理解,不一定正確,主要用來整理思路。2、MVC是三個單詞的首字母縮寫,它們是Model(模型)、View(檢視)和Controller(控制)。這個模式認為,程...
- 8244
- mvc框架是模型(model)-檢視(view)-控制器(controller)的縮寫,一種軟體設計典範。mvc框架用一種業務邏輯、資料、介面顯示分離的方法組織程式碼,將業務邏輯聚集到一個部件裡面,在改進和個性化定製介面及使用者互動的同時,不需要重新編寫業務邏輯。mvc框架被獨特的發展起來用於對映傳...
- 13985
- 1、首先建立父容器(AnnotationConfigWebApplicationContext),通過自定義的getRootConfigClasses()拿到配置類,並註冊到父容器中。2、通過父容器作為引數建立ContextLoaderListener監聽器。並新增到servletContext(Tomcatservlet容器)。3、通過自定的getServletConfigClasses(...
- 29509